VScode运行代码选择

JFe*_*ern 13 python debugging visual-studio-code

为了我的 Python 工作,我刚刚从 Spyder 过渡到了 VScode。有没有办法运行单独的代码行?这就是我过去进行现场调试的方式,但是我在 VScode 中找不到它的选项,并且真的不想继续设置和删除断点。

谢谢。

Bre*_*non 5

如果突出显示某些代码,则可以右键单击或运行命令Run Selection/Line in Python Terminal.

我们还计划实施 Ctrl-Enter来做同样的事情,并查看Ctr-Enter 执行当前行


BCA*_*Arg 5

你可以:

  1. 在“终端”>“新终端”中打开终端
  2. 突出显示您要运行的代码
  3. 点击终端>运行选定的文本

对于 R,您可以点击CTRL Enter执行突出显示的代码。对于 python 显然没有默认的快捷方式(见下文),但我很确定你可以添加你的。

在此输入图像描述


Anh*_*ham 1

一种方法是通过集成终端。这是打开/使用它的指南:https ://code.visualstudio.com/docs/editor/integrated-terminal

之后,输入python3python因为它取决于您使用的版本。然后,将要运行的代码部分复制并粘贴到终端中。它现在具有与 Spyder 中的控制台相同的功能。希望这可以帮助。